Output a580bd3217905f55507ff78cc085a1c3e194d30bb4b9baba51d3be7891fe40b8: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5d48feb51d2facc308b69216dc2a6d8ce1fe2dc OP_EQUAL
address
3Q6r7d1ezTkaunkXuMzW33rTJFuq3DMZ66
transaction
a580bd3217905f55507ff78cc085a1c3e194d30bb4b9baba51d3be7891fe40b8
confirmations
214632
spent
true